public class SagaServerClient extends Object
| 构造器和说明 |
|---|
SagaServerClient(SagaLevel3Config level3Config)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
rollbackFailure(String gid,
long time,
org.beetl.sql.saga.common.SagaTransaction tasks) |
void |
rollbackSuccess(String gid,
long time) |
void |
sendRollbackTask(String gid,
long time,
org.beetl.sql.saga.common.SagaTransaction tasks)
发送回滚任务到服务器
|
void |
sendRollbackTaskInCommit(String gid,
long time,
org.beetl.sql.saga.common.SagaTransaction tasks)
发送回滚任务到服务器
|
void |
start(String gid,
long time)
标记开始
|
public SagaServerClient(SagaLevel3Config level3Config)
public void start(String gid, long time)
gid - time - public void sendRollbackTask(String gid, long time, org.beetl.sql.saga.common.SagaTransaction tasks)
tasks - public void sendRollbackTaskInCommit(String gid, long time, org.beetl.sql.saga.common.SagaTransaction tasks)
tasks - public void rollbackSuccess(String gid, long time)
public void rollbackFailure(String gid, long time, org.beetl.sql.saga.common.SagaTransaction tasks)
Copyright © 2020. All rights reserved.